Llmo for Bush Lands.— An interestinc feature of farming practice In the hnsti country of Gatlins lids year Is the marked popularity of lime. Deliveries have been unusually heavy, and there are very few holdings that have not received liberal dressings, many of them for the first lime. Experience has shown Hint on hush soils, and particularly on moss hanks, lime produces excellent results when applied in tile early spring prior to the sowing of either crops or pasliiP's, a fact which bad not been fully appreciated in Ihe past by Gatlins fanners as a whole. In tills district and in other pads “f Smith nt.igo ns well, there has been evident a realisation of the fad that liming is essential before the host results ran he obtained from the use of other manures.
